>> In the function rxe_create_cq, when rxe_cq_from_init fails, the function
>> rxe_cleanup will be called to handle the allocated resources. In fact,
>> some memory resources have already been freed in the function
>> rxe_cq_from_init. Thus, this problem will occur.
>>
>> The solution is to let rxe_cleanup do all the work.

>> drivers/infiniband/sw/rxe/rxe_cq.c | 5 +----
>> 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 4 deletions(-)
>>
>> di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/sw/rxe/rxe_cq.c b/drivers/infiniband/sw/rxe/rxe_cq.c
>> index fec87c9030ab..fffd144d509e 100644
>> --- a/drivers/infiniband/sw/rxe/rxe_cq.c
>> +++ b/drivers/infiniband/sw/rxe/rxe_cq.c
>> @@ -56,11 +56,8 @@ int rxe_cq_from_init(struct rxe_dev *rxe, struct rxe_cq *cq, int cqe,
>>
>> err = do_mmap_info(rxe, uresp ? &uresp->mi : NULL, udata,
>> cq->queue->buf, cq->queue->buf_size, &cq->queue->ip);
>> - if (err) {
>> - vfree(cq->queue->buf);
>> - kfree(cq->queue);
>> + if (err)
>> return err;
>> - }
>>
>> cq->is_user = uresp;
